Growing up with ADHD has its share of challenges. But did you know that ADHD also comes with special abilities? This book is all about using your unique talents and strengths to overcome challenges and make ADHD your superpower! Addie and friends all have ADHD, but it presents differently for each one. As the characters navigate ADHD in school, at home and in their friendships, readers are prompted to consider their own individual challenges and abilities. In addition to helping kids harness their special strengths, the story addresses self-esteem, mindfulness and other building blocks of mental and emotional wellbeing through relatable scenarios. ADHD isn't easy, but learning to embrace it can have incredible results. Building the skills for our individual journeys Young readers will join Addie and friends as they learn about Attention Deficit and Hyperactivity Disorder, and the many different ways it can present. From inattention to impulsivity, this book demonstrates how becoming more aware of our symptoms allows us to develop our coping skills and strategies for success. Using positivity to support self esteem When ADHD feels like a setback, self-esteem can suffer. But by focusing on the positive traits linked to ADHD—intelligence, creativity, enthusiasm and outside-the-box thinking—kids can learn to harness their strengths, build resilience and achieve their potential. Backed by therapists and mental health professionals This book is based on FocusEDTx, a digital therapeutic program from Cognitive Leap. Developed by therapists, FocusEDTx features interactive content that teaches the science behind ADHD and making neurodiversity an asset.
